POST OFFICE NOTICES.

HAILS CLO3B FOB Wallacetown, Winton, Benmore, Lowther, Athol, Nokoinai, and Lake Wakatip, this day, at 1 p.m. Riverton and Crummy's Bush, to-morrow, 15th inst., at 10 a.m. Dunedin, Mataura, G-ore, Long Bush, and Switzer's Diggings, to-morrow, loth inst., at 10 a.m. Per b. 3. Aldinga, on Monday, 18th instant, as under — For Ceylon, India, Singapore, Batavia, Manilla, China, Aden, Mauritius. Cape of GroodHope, Suez, Alexandria, America, the Continent of Em-ope vid Trieatc, and North Europe via London, at 3.30 p.m. Queensland, New South Wales, Adelaide, Western Australia, and Tasmania, at 4 p.m. Great Britain vid Southampton, at 4.30 p.m. London vid Marseilles and Victoria, at 5 p.m. Newspapers, at 3.30 p.m. j Registered Letters, at 3.30 p.m. j Money Orders for transmission by the above Mails may be procured until 4 p.m. Late letters for the Australian Colonies and J Great Britain only will be received up to 5.50 p.m. \ Such letters to have a late fee of Is. (one shilling) J in addition to all postage, the whole to be affixed i | in postage stamps. j i j ! It is hereby notified that, in consequence of the | removal of Mr. Myers, tobacconist, Tay- street, the reeieving box for letters formerly fixed in Ms Bhop has been removed. Ebw. D. Bctts, Chief Postmaster, i Chief Post Office, i Southland, 13th July, 1864.
